Several factors are fueling the rapid growth of the RMM software market. The widespread adoption of remote work models necessitates efficient and secure management of dispersed IT infrastructure. RMM solutions provide the essential tools for monitoring, controlling, and troubleshooting remote devices, ensuring business continuity and productivity. Simultaneously, the exponential increase in the number of connected devices across various industries creates a need for centralized management and security. RMM software effectively addresses this challenge by offering a unified platform to monitor and manage diverse devices, simplifying IT operations. Furthermore, the increasing sophistication of cyber threats necessitates proactive security measures. RMM solutions play a crucial role in identifying and mitigating security vulnerabilities, protecting businesses from costly data breaches and downtime. The demand for improved IT efficiency and reduced operational costs is another key driver. RMM software streamlines IT processes, automating tasks such as software updates, security patching, and remote troubleshooting, ultimately leading to significant cost savings. Finally, the rise of cloud-based RMM solutions enhances accessibility, scalability, and affordability, making the technology more accessible to businesses of all sizes.
Despite the significant growth potential, the RMM software market faces several challenges. The complexity of integrating RMM solutions with existing IT infrastructure can be a significant hurdle for some organizations, particularly those with legacy systems. This complexity can necessitate substantial upfront investment in training and expertise, potentially delaying adoption. Security concerns remain a major consideration. RMM solutions, by their nature, require access to sensitive data and systems, raising concerns about potential vulnerabilities and data breaches. Ensuring robust security protocols and compliance with data privacy regulations is critical for vendors and users alike. Furthermore, the need for ongoing maintenance and updates can pose a challenge. RMM platforms are constantly evolving to address new security threats and technological advancements, requiring regular updates and maintenance to ensure optimal performance and security. The cost of RMM software can also be a barrier, particularly for smaller businesses with limited IT budgets. Balancing the cost of the solution with its long-term benefits requires careful consideration. Finally, the increasing competition in the market leads to price pressure, necessitating vendors to continuously innovate and improve their offerings to maintain a competitive edge.
